+title: Mediatek MT6370 SubPMIC
+
+maintainers:
+ - ChiYuan Huang <cy_huang@richtek.com>
+
+description: |
+ MT6370 is a highly-integrated smart power management IC, which includes a
+ single cell Li-Ion/Li-Polymer switching battery charger, a USB Type-C &
+ Power Delivery (PD) controller, dual flash LED current sources, a RGB LED
+ driver, a backlight WLED driver, a display bias driver and a general LDO for
+ portable devices.
